Title: **Christian Muller: A Pioneer in Magnetocaloric Technology**
Introduction
Christian Muller, based in Strasbourg, France, stands out as an innovative inventor with an impressive portfolio of 37 patents. His work primarily focuses on advanced energy conversion technologies, particularly in the field of magnetocaloric systems. Latest Patents
Among Christian Muller's latest patents is the **Magnetocaloric Generator**. This groundbreaking invention outlines a novel generator design that leverages porous active elements derived from Magnetic Colloidal Materials (MCM) incorporated into a magnetic arrangement with two superposed magnetic rotors: an external magnetic rotor and an internal magnetic rotor. The design optimizes the axial circulation of heat-transfer fluid between differing temperature zones, enhancing energy conversion efficiency.
Another notable patent is for a **Machine for Converting Thermal Energy into Electrical Energy or Vice Versa**. This innovative machine captures waste heat through a magnetothermal converter, effectively converting it into electrical energy. By exploiting the magnetic phase transition properties of certain materials, the machine orchestrates a synchronization system that alternates thermal cycles, resulting in mechanical energy conversion through magnetic imbalance.
